The September dry spell ended in a big way for many in some of the area last night including Dubuque.
The rain came down hard and fast for some in the city with the storm dumping between 1 and 2.5 inches of rain in under one hour creating some street flooding. There was also up to penny size hail reported.
Not everyone received nearly as much rain with the Dubuque Regional Airport only recording just .57 inches.
Up until yesterday, the airport only had .19 inches of precipitation for the month.
